Stride, Inc. (NYSE:LRN) Shares Acquired by Bright Futures Wealth Management LLC.

Bright Futures Wealth Management LLC. lifted its stake in shares of Stride, Inc. (NYSE:LRNFree Report) by 12.3% during the first quarter, HoldingsChannel.com reports. The firm owned 9,065 shares of the company’s stock after purchasing an additional 992 shares during the period. Stride accounts for about 1.3% of Bright Futures Wealth Management LLC.’s portfolio, making the stock its 24th largest position. Bright Futures Wealth Management LLC.’s holdings in Stride were worth $1,206,000 at the end of the most recent reporting period.

Stride Price Performance

NYSE:LRN opened at $145.87 on Friday. The firm has a market cap of $6.35 billion, a price-to-earnings ratio of 22.76, a price-to-earnings-growth ratio of 1.03 and a beta of 0.35. The company has a current ratio of 5.61, a quick ratio of 5.53 and a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.33. The company’s 50-day moving average is $147.30 and its two-hundred day moving average is $131.02. Stride, Inc. has a 12-month low of $63.25 and a 12-month high of $162.30.

Stride (NYSE:LRNGet Free Report) last released its earnings results on Tuesday, April 29th. The company reported $2.02 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, missing analysts’ consensus estimates of $2.09 by ($0.07). The firm had revenue of $613.38 million during the quarter, compared to analysts’ expectations of $591.15 million. Stride had a net margin of 13.10% and a return on equity of 23.36%. Stride’s revenue for the quarter was up 17.8% on a year-over-year basis. During the same quarter last year, the company posted $1.60 earnings per share. Research analysts expect that Stride, Inc. will post 6.67 EPS for the current year.

Stride Profile

(Free Report)

Stride, Inc, a technology-based education service company, engages in the provision of proprietary and third-party online curriculum, software systems, and educational services in the United States and internationally. Its technology-based products and services enable clients to attract, enroll, educate, track progress, support, and facilitate individualized learning for students.
